PCIe 4.0 is twice as fast as PCIe 3.0. PCIe 4.0 has a 16 GT/s data rate, compared to its predecessor's 8 GT/s. In addition, each PCIe 4.0 lane configuration supports double the bandwidth of PCIe 3.0, maxing out at 32 GB/s in a 16-lane slot, or 64 GB/s with bidirectional travel considered.

It'll work fine. PCIe 3.0 x4 m.2 SSD, m key, size 2280 fits and works well in PCIe 4.0 x4 m.2, most motherboards. For further confirmation you can post model number or specification of both SSD and motherboard. The 4.0 slot is backwards compatible but don't expect 4.0 speeds from a 3.0 drive.

PCIe is also backward compatible. If you have a PCIe 4.0 graphics card you can use it with a motherboard designed for PCIe 3.0; however, the card's available bandwidth would be limited to the capabilities of PCIe 3.0. Conversely, a PCIe 3.0 card can fit in a PCIe 4.0 slot, but again it would be limited by PCIe 3.0.

PCIe 4.0 SSD Supported Motherboard Chipsets. The motherboard primarily determines the PCIe version of the M.2 slot. Both AMD and Intel currently provide motherboards that enable 4.0 PCIe SSDs. The following AMD chipsets are compatible with 4.0 SSDs: AMD X570: Premium Chipset with PCIe 4.0-compliant CPU and Chipset lanes.

YES is the short and simple answer to whether a PCIe 4.0 device can work in a PCIe 3.0 slot. You can plug a PCIe 4.0 device, like a graphics card, into a PCIe 3.0 slot. Thanks to the flexible PCIe interface, the device and the slots are cross and backward-compatible. You can plug in a newer device in an older place and vice versa.
